FMC (NYSE:FMC – Get Free Report) had its price objective decreased by investment analysts at Citigroup from $17.00 to $14.00 in a report released on Thursday,Benzinga reports. The brokerage presently has a “neutral” rating on the basic materials company’s stock. Citigroup’s target price would indicate a potential upside of 2.15% from the stock’s current price.
A number of other analysts also recently weighed in on the stock. Barclays downgraded shares of FMC from an “equal weight” rating to an “underweight” rating and decreased their price target for the stock from $16.00 to $13.00 in a research report on Tuesday, December 9th. Wall Street Zen lowered FMC from a “hold” rating to a “sell” rating in a research report on Saturday, November 8th. JPMorgan Chase & Co. decreased their price objective on shares of FMC from $43.00 to $14.00 and set a “neutral” rating for the company in a report on Monday, November 17th. Mizuho dropped their target price on shares of FMC from $30.00 to $24.00 and set an “outperform” rating on the stock in a report on Monday. Finally, Royal Bank Of Canada decreased their price target on shares of FMC from $33.00 to $17.00 and set an “outperform” rating for the company in a report on Friday, October 31st. Three analysts have rated the stock with a Buy rating, ten have assigned a Hold rating and three have given a Sell rating to the company’s stock. Based on data from MarketBeat, FMC currently has a consensus rating of “Hold” and an average target price of $26.46.

FMC Stock Down 0.5%
FMC (NYSE:FMC – Get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ings data on Wednesday, October 29th. The basic materials company reported $0.89 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of $0.85 by $0.04. FMC had a negative net margin of 14.81% and a positive return on equity of 10.40%. The company had revenue of $542.20 million during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$1.08 billion. During the same quarter last year, the company earned $0.69 earnings per share. FMC’s revenue for the quarter was down 49.1% on a year-over-year basis. FMC has set its Q4 2025 guidance at 1.140-1.360 EPS and its FY 2025 guidance at 2.920-3.140 EPS. As a group, sell-side analysts expect that FMC will post 3.48 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

About FMC
FMC Corporation, an agricultural sciences company, provides crop protection, plant health, and professional pest and turf management products. It develops, markets, and sells crop protection chemicals that includes insecticides, herbicides, and fungicides; and biologicals, crop nutrition, and seed treatment products, which are used in agriculture to enhance crop yield and quality by controlling a range of insects, weeds, and diseases, as well as in non-agricultural markets for pest control.
